You must determine the size of your pet's head and paws before installing a cat flap. Then, you can buy an enclosure that is the appropriate size. Once you have the right dimensions then you can begin putting it into your door.

Most DIY'ers are wary of installing their own cat flap because of the fear of causing damage to the door or making it difficult for their pet to use. But with a little expertise and the proper tools, it's not an insurmountable challenge for anyone to take on.

UPVC panels are constructed from a thin plastic outer skin, which is then bonded to a soft insulating polystyrene inner core that can be cut using an electric jigsaw equipped with a fine cutting blade. The material is strong and doesn't degrade over time, so it will last longer than traditional wooden doors.

Once you have the panel in place, you can test its operation to make sure that the pet flap can open and close with no difficulty. If the flap is stuck, you can make use of a file or a rasp to smooth any rough edges of the flap and prevent them from forming a bind on any object.

If you want to install a cat flap in your uPVC door, it is important to do it correctly. First, you need to find the right location for the flap. If you can, place it close to the middle of the door. You will also be able install the cat flap without affecting the structural integrity of your door. It is recommended to employ a spirit level to ensure that the hole you're cutting will be flush with the door's surface. It is also a good idea to mark the position of the flap with pencil. This will help you avoid any blunders and ensure that the flap is correctly placed.

It is crucial that you do not place your cat flap too high. A flap that is too high can let cold air into your home and cause drafts. This can be uncomfortable for both your pet and your family members. If your cats aren't big enough, they might not be able to get through the flap. In this case you may want to consider installing a smaller flap.
